Recently I came across a RID Optimus Prime MIB for a reasonable price, so I picked it up.
I had heard much praise for RID Prime over the years and passed on one in 2006, kicking myself afterwards.
It prompted me to retrieve my other Optimus Prime figures from the boxed collection. Seeing those different takes on the same design made me think how Optimus is the only character to appear in every single continuity. It would be a cool sub-collection to have all the different OP characters together. That is characters, not molds or bodies.
According to TFwiki, these are the continuities from which I need an Optimus:
- Generation One
- Robots in Disguise
- Unicron Trilogy
- Movieverse
- Animated
- Aligned
There are more continuities out there, but for different reasons, I didn't include them:
- Beast Era
Technically, it's part of the G1 continuity. Prime exists alongside Primal, excluding the need for the latter to represent his continuity. Besides that, I don't want a single animal alongside all the trucks.
- TransTech
A cool, different take on OP, but alas the toys never got released.
- Go-Bots, 1st TransFormers
There's no OP in these toylines. The newest Rescue Bots has one, but he's very G1.
- Universe
Nothing but repaints in this series, which simply combines previously existing universes. The two unique Optimuses are a repaint of the RID spychanger and a comic-only amalgation of various OP designs.
- Shattered Glass
The toy is a repaint of a G1 design, as is most of this continuity. His colours would look out of place, as well.
Excluding those, that leaves six Optimus Primes and my goal is to get the ones that best represent the universe they're from.
G1: I've got the Deluxe figure from the Ultimate Battle box set, which isn't that good. I dig the robot mode, but the vehicle lacks a cohesive shape and part of me wants to represent G1 with an actual G1 Prime, or at least a reissue.
RID: It's either the Super figure or the spychanger and that choice is easy. And well, the Super figure is the reason I started this sub-collection.
Movieverse: I've got the RotF Leader, but he resides in my main collection. The only other detailed Movie Prime I've got is the first film's Voyager. Eh, he's good enough and I'm not going to double dip on another variation of the RotF Leader.
Animated: I have the Deluxe Battle Begins box set figure, with battle damage. The Voyager is technically better, being more complex and show-accurate, but he's so similar it's not worth it to me. I also kinda dig the cartoony battle damage and how they set him apart from the others.
Aligned: Here's where it gets weird. I've got WFC Optimus (Rage over Cybertron repaint), but to me WFC is a G1 story, apart from Prime. I can ignore that and follow official continuity, but that would mean he's the same guy as Prime OP. Prime Optimus Prime (First Edition) looks cool, but the style isn't really all that unique. G1 is retro and blocky, RID is very Japanese and highly stylized, Movie is nano-detailed and alien, Animated is smooth and curvy, A/E/C is chunky, gimmicky and chock full of delicious sci-fi detailing. Prime Prime is pretty much Movie Prime in silhouette and upper body, with Animated inspired detailing. So as far as I'm concerned, WFC Prime is my Aligned Optimus Prime.
A/E/C: The only continuity from which I'm lacking an Optimus. There are basically three versions I'm looking for here, but they're so different, it's hard to see them as the same character. I'm leaning towards the Cybertron Leader, since it looks far more awesome than the Armada and Energon guys. Cybertron's figures are also packed with more articulation and better gimmicks than the other two series. Plus, he's got a removable Matrix and faceplate, which no other Prime in my collectio has.

Generation 1, Generation 2
You can never go wrong with the G1 original. One tip I should give though is to look for Japanese reissues if you have the money, as the US reissues have the smokestacks trimmed and the missiles elongated.
Another version worth seeking out, aside from the desired Classics Voyager, is the G2 Laser Optimus Prime, simply the best toy of his time. He even has a new trailer.
Beast Wars
There are no more than 3 Optimusses (well, including the Japanese Convoys) in this era, one for each series. Since you don't want animals in your setup will casually skip that.
Robots in Disguise
You already have the only large toy, and I don't blame you
Unicron Trilogy
This one's iffy, not only because there are indeed three separate designs of him, but Japan first considered their version of Energon and Cybertron separate series and not sequels. So Energon and Cybertron Prime were separate characters at first. For the sake of simplicity, stick with the Cybertron version.
Live Action Movies
The general opinion is that RotF Leader Prime is the best out there, and for good reason. Since you already have one and I assume want a second, look at some of the (really expensive) Japanese versions. I'd recommend looking at either Buster or Striker, or if you have a lot of cash to blow, at Jetwing.
Animated
Easy: Voyager wins hands down. If you want a special display, look into the shiny Japanese edition.
Prime
Unlike Hasbro, I do not consider WFC and Prime Prime the same character. As such, I prefer the First Edition for lack of obstructing gimmick. Not to worry though, rumor has it that Hasbro is looking into a re-release in Fall.
War for Cybertron
Another easy one: Generations with the design from the first game.

Power Master Prime is also a good representation, but not nearly as iconic.
G2 Laser Rod Prime is one of the greats of its time as well. though I'm trying to track down the Exclusive Ultra Magnus repaint at a decent price.
Jumping ahead to R.I.D. he's is the number 1 figure in my collection and the sole reason I started collecting as an adult, he's just that awesome. He also makes the core to one of the more impressive and chrome-tastic Prime Supermodes since Power Master Prime.
Armada pays homage to the Primes of the Past, and I think he's iconic in that he's the first one to return to the classic Truck and trailer combo from G1/G2 since Star Convoy. He is quite motionless, but packs quite a lot of features. There's also the more poseable deluxe with Minicon partner Over-Run. He's quite nice and has seen a few repaints so should be easier to find.
Energon Prime is not as good by himself, he really needs Wing Saber to shine, so I would skip him, though personally I do like him quite a bit.
Cybertron Prime on the other hand is blocky, poseable, and loaded with features. He's the one I suggest getting, if and only if the immobility of Armada Prime is not your cup of tea.
Classics Voyager is the one to own.
Animmted Voyager again the one to choose. Deluxe Earth Mode Prime though has the benefit of the better looking axe though.
ROTF all the way for the movie primes , so many ROTF repaints and remolds out there there should be no problem getting one.
F.E. Prime for Prime Prime

Generation One
I went and picked up the 25th anniversary edition of G1 Prime, since I was really adement that an actual G1 mold represented the original OP. It also comes with the trailer and Roller, which I've always found interesting inclusions.
I know there are other toys out there which look far more like the cartoon, like the Robot Masters, Classics Voyager, Hybrid Style and the two Masterpiece molds. I know this sounds really silly, but I actually prefer the simplistic G1 toy over all the modern recreations, because it's actually part of and has the features of the G1 toyline; die-cast, funky 80's-licious stickers and a simple transformation and articulation.
Aside from the neo-G1 designs, there are several unique looking figures I decided against, because they all represent G1 Optimus but lack the iconic look.
These are;
Powermaster - Small robot is just like the G1 figure, super robot is also too similar.
Star Convoy - Very bricky robot, sci-fi alt mode. Shape and colors don't give me the OP vibe
Machine Wars - Not originally intended as the character and despite his trailer, this shows.
Gobot - Cars never look much like OP, even in these colours. Also a repaint of a non-OP.
Laser - Cool and much celebrated. But the alt is like Movie OP and the torso takes too much after G1.
Hero - White truck cab that ends up on the legs = wrong. Upper body looks just like Laser OP.
Alternators - A pick-up, which is close enough, but the robot doesn't look too good, especially those shoulders.
Alternity - A car and he's only got his head and colours to give the OP vibe. Also expensive for a deluxe.
Beast Wars
I actually forgot about Optimal Optimus. The only non-organic beast OPs I remembered were Transmetal Optimus, which lacks any resemblance to the typical OP design, and the Leobreaker retool in red and blue.
Optimal Optimus actually features a wheeled mode, which makes more sense in a convoy. His beast mode can easily be ignored and although his alt modes don't look like much, the robot is very cool. I'm considering the Primal Prime repaint to represent the Beast Era Optimus.
Robots in Disguise
There's also a Titanium version of RID Prime. Not that this changes anything =)
Unicron Trilogy
I went back and forth over this and ultimately decided to get all three, with the big trailer towing versions for Armada and Energon. The trailers just add so much to the vehicle modes and add more Super modes for the display.
Movieverse
I don't want a second RotF leader, but my 2007 Voyager isn't too impressive either. With his trailer-towing collegues in mind, I might go for the Movie Trilogy Deluxe figure with trailer. His shape is more movie-accurate than the first Voyager mold and his trailer has an inside, unlike Ultimate Optimus, who can stay in my movieverse display as Ultra Magnus.
Animated
I looked up some pictorial comparisons between the Voyager and Deluxe molds. While the Voyager has a more show-accurate alt-mode in shape and colours, I don't prefer his robot mode over the Deluxe. It's more intricately detailed sure, but that makes for a less clean and sleek robot mode, which is what the Animated aesthetic is all about. In order to represent this universe, Deluxe Battle Begins OP may stay.
War for Cybertron
It's a pre-cartoon G1 game in my mind, but the design is different enough to include him. That gives Titanium War Within Optimus a reason to want in and he might be on to something.
Prime
The design might be animated movieverse, but FE Voyager OP looks awesome enough to ignore that and give him a chance too. The P-RID edition is decent enough to get if I see it before Hasbro announces concrete plans for FE rereleases.
I know this all sounds a bit stupid. Some are too close to the G1 design, others too different. The thing is, I'm looking for that thin line on which a design can balance which makes him instantly recognisable as an Optimus, without instantly reminding you of any other specific version of Optimus.

Meet Universe 2003 Nemesis Prime, a corrupted clone of a deceased alternate universe Optimus Prime. A servant of Unicron who carries the Dead Matrix, the antithesis of the Creation Matrix. Almost impossible to find (I so want one!
